Transaction 5f210aa882769ede6dc0f8e54215226b74a3df6119127af609da406fc7110aa1
1 Input
1 Output
-
5f210aa882769ede6dc0f8e54215226b74a3df6119127af609da406fc7110aa1:0
- value
- 789152
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ec3085fe7c48d80a965289e09da1fb436eb8501 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12M46oB9XRV5YmWH9Zb8Dd6VBo6Bwm5A66